    A couple of days ago, iTunes wouldn't download podcasts. 
    I had to unsubscribte the podcast then subscribe again.  iTunes  would only then download the most recent podcast.
    iTunes used to download ALL podcasts that were not downloaded.  It would check every hour (60 minutes) for available podcasts for downloading.
    Now, I have to search each podcast for episodes with the Cloud symbol.  It is a pain to do that.  there is no "Download all" option that would download every episode available.   Also, according to the "Settings" option , iTunes checks for new episodes 10 minutes past the hour, then does not download any.

  • Podcast not downloading automatically

    I have multiple podcast that I have set up to download automatically thru the podcast app, but there is one that does not update. When I go into the podcast and try to download it manually it freezes then crashes. Any help would be great.

    I have a similar issue but in our case, it's not crashing. We have three podcasts running, 2 of which work just fine. But the daily podcast seems to have stopped at Feb 5, 2013 for existing subscribers only. New subscribers get all of the episodes. What we did find is if the subscriber clicks "show all available episodes," it updates and then continues to work just fine.

  • How do I turn off the feature that stops downloading podcasts because I haven't listened for a period of time?

    iTunes automatically stops downloading podcasts when I haven't listened to them for some arbitrary period of time. I want to turn this off so it always downloads.

    iTunes will stop updating a podcast subscription if you have more than five episodes downloaded but not listened to, as detailed in this page:
    http://support.apple.com/kb/TA23353
    which states:
    You've subscribed to a podcast but have more than five unplayed episodes. iTunes will stop automatically downloading newer episodes. You may get the following message:
    iTunes has stopped updating this podcast because you have not listened to any episodes recently. Would you like to resume updating this podcast?
    You can click Yes to continue downloading additional episodes. Or you can just listen to any part of any episode and a new episode will download at the next update.
    There is no setting in iTunes to change this, but there is an AppleScript available which will apparently deal with this (I've not tried it):
    http://dougscripts.com/itunes/scripts/ss.php?sp=updateexpiredpodcasts
